About

Asian International Model United Nations (AIMUN) is an annual conference hosted by the School of International Studies, Peking University, organized by Peking University Model United Nations Association. Since its inception in 2007, AIMUN has held 14 successful conferences and will be returning with its 15th edition in May 2023. As the largest and most influential collegiate international Model United Nations (MUN) conference in China, AIMUN provides a valuable communication platform for youths sharing a common interest in international affairs to discuss a wide range of hot-button issues with delegates from diverse cultural backgrounds. In this process, we hope that delegates will be able to embrace the diversity of viewpoints and at the same time showcase the unique perspectives of Asia. In the coming year, AIMUN will remain committed to our goals, building on the good work of our predecessors and seeking to open up new prospects through innovation.

This year, AIMUN will be held onsite in Beijing in May 2023. The theme of AIMUN 2023 will be “Sustainable Development: The Future is Now”,  where a total of 8 committees will be convened. The conference will be based mainly on simulations of international multilateral conferences and negotiations, with esteemed leaders, scholars, and professionals from international organizations joining in the sessions to share their opinions with our delegates and engage in meaningful dialogues. 

 

In today's world, sustainable development has been extended to all aspects of a nation's survival and development.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) are also part of China's 14th Five-Year Plan, which emphasizes high-quality green development. In response to the social and environmental challenges that have emerged after decades of rapid growth, and in view of China's large population and growing international influence, it is vital for China to play a key role in the global journey towards sustainable development by actively pursuing relevant initiatives and policies. As such, while remaining roots in China, AIMUN 2023 will keep eyes on the world, focusing on the aforementioned areas and aiming to encourage MUNers to pay attention to current global issues and actively contribute their wisdom and strength to sustainable development.
